Output 26316efa085a5243bddb9826a754bd505ca55a2462c9aed8d239e8b8651cdb0a:0

value
183778
script pubkey
OP_0 OP_PUSHBYTES_20 2a943e8d320799fe34a7b95cd72c6ebb3ed73db4
address
bc1q922rarfjq7vlud98h9wdwtrwhvldw0d5dehdwx
transaction
26316efa085a5243bddb9826a754bd505ca55a2462c9aed8d239e8b8651cdb0a
spent
true